Water Main Break Near Pope High School

Some residences have been affected and a portion of Hembree Road has been closed for most of today.

Update, 10:45 pm. 

The single lane of Hembree Road is expected to be closed until around midnight and is expected to be open by Friday morning, according to a Tweet from Cobb County Government at 10:30 p.m.

Update, 5:40 p.m.

Cobb County Government indicated that one lane of Hembree Road near Meadow Drive will be closed until around 9 p.m. tonight.

Original report:


A water main break near Pope High School today has affected traffic on Hembree Road and cut off water service to some nearby residences. 

Cobb County Government spokesman Robert Quigley told East Cobb Patch shortly after 1 p.m. today that service to around 36 residences has been affected since around noon, when a six-inch break occurred on a main on Hembree Road. 

The accident also shut down traffic on Hembree Road for a while. 

The affected area of Hembree Road is near Meadow Drive, and just north of the Pope campus.

Quigley said there is not an estimated time for the completion of the repairs.
